Output 603e0b1c1ae7c6308ae39bcf4dc51a676d233c8027ec2a4e992d241976838ae6:2

value
139944088
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f86c25d9f4618f11d8641503e1b4f8ad2cabbbd4 OP_EQUALVERIFY OP_CHECKSIG
address
1PeY8pVNqGSszS5No42oWWBomDc3B7WTiR
transaction
603e0b1c1ae7c6308ae39bcf4dc51a676d233c8027ec2a4e992d241976838ae6
spent
true